Analysis

The most recent figure for waste — emissions (co2eq) from n2o in Albania is 130.91 kt, measured in 2023. That is the highest value across all 63 years on record.

The figure is up 1.2% on the previous year and up 15.2% over ten years.

Over the whole period, waste — emissions (co2eq) from n2o in Albania peaked at 130.91 kt in 2023 and was at its lowest, 36.57 kt, in 1961.

Albania ranks 101st of 201 countries on this measure, in the middle of the range.

The long-run direction has been consistently rising across the 63 years of available data.

The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
